Transaction 71c0890f109a2fcc808193781f26685312a1446c92b80e429bc9dad760718825

2 Input
2 Outputs
  • 71c0890f109a2fcc808193781f26685312a1446c92b80e429bc9dad760718825:0
  • value  399996850
    address  mjw4VFTBByvyq17Jhdbob5JX35PeCxZQCx
  • 71c0890f109a2fcc808193781f26685312a1446c92b80e429bc9dad760718825:1
  • value  396425863
    address  2Mtczp47PZWLsbzBgz9rm2FhpWGLrZcwmuH